## **Antiscalant Market Trends**

Due to the worldwide shortage of water resources, there is a growing need for water consumption for both urban and industrial uses. Government laws are strictly followed by municipalities and industries while handling water and wastewater. Most water treatment companies deal with scaling as one of their common global concerns. During membrane operations, the bulk of scale fouling is detected. One type of specialist chemical that water treatment firms can employ to address this problem is antiscalant.

The use of antiscalant enhances process efficiency by lowering the cost and duration of cleaning and maintenance, which is predicted to boost the antiscalant market CAGR. Antiscalants are widely utilized in pipeline transportation, membrane treatment, desalination, and water refinement processes. These are also frequently employed to keep RO membrane systems free of mineral scaling issues.

The expansion of the mining sector in APAC is being driven by the rising number of new mining projects being undertaken to satisfy the region's expanding industrial demand. In Australia, work on a new coal mine started in 2019. The project received about A$800 million (US$ 554 million) in initial funding. By 2023, the project is expected to be operational. Furthermore, in an effort to reduce reliance on imports and move closer to its objective of producing one billion tonnes of coal by 2023–2034, the Indian government-owned Coal India Ltd (CIL) authorized 32 mining projects in March 2021.

Therefore, the need for antiscalants is being supported by the expansion of new mining products in APAC. Thus, driving the antiscalant market revenue.

### **Antiscalant Type Insights**

The APAC Antiscalant market segmentation, based on type includes [Calcium Carbonate](../../../reports/calcium-carbonate-market-5383), Phosphonates, Sulphates, Fluorides, Magnesium, Calcium Sulfate and Others. The phosphonates segment dominated the market mostly since it is frequently utilized in formulations for water treatment that include iron sequestrants, corrosion and scale inhibitors, and both. Because phosphonates combine several activities into a single molecule, they are effective at low concentrations. These are also employed in the production of bleaching chemicals as a stabilizing agent. Ozone and hydrogen peroxide oxidize phosphonate antiscalants. Phosphate oxidation is increased when the phosphonate and dissolved calcium ions work together.

### **Antiscalant Method Insights**

The APAC Antiscalant market segmentation, based on method, includes Threshold Inhibition, Crystal Modification and Dispersion. The threshold inhibition category generated the most income. It is described as an antiscalant's capacity to adsorb on crystals or colloidal particles and transfer a high anionic charge that facilitates crystal separation.

### **Antiscalant Ore Insights**

The APAC Antiscalant market segmentation, based on ore, includes Aluminum, Iron, Copper, Gold, Cobalt, Nickel, Coal and Others. The coal category generated the most income. By stopping or postponing the formation of barium, strontium sulfate, silicate, and metallic oxides, antiscalants are used in coal mining to maintain the membrane layer's filtration flow at ideal rates. The APAC region's coal mining industry is expanding due to a number of causes, including government initiatives and growing investments from international coal corporations.
